How many views does Dog Grooming Studio actually get?

This channel runs on hits: its top 10% of videos pull 53% of all views and its biggest is 30.8× the median, so the median upload (26K views) is the floor and the big numbers are the exception.

How much does Dog Grooming Studio make? (estimated)

Nobody outside the channel sees the real figure, and ad revenue is only part of it - sponsorships and merch often dwarf it. But from public view counts, Dog Grooming Studio pulls roughly 34K long-form views a month from recent uploads, which at a typical $1-4 RPM works out to an estimated $34-$134 a month in ad revenue (about $402-$1,610 a year). Treat it as a ballpark, not a payslip - real creator income varies wildly, and this ignores the back catalogue.
